When I worry that they might be suffering from hypothermia,I know chickens are fine in the cold as long as they have a dry draft free coop, but in theory would i be able to tell if them were cold? Would they just huddle together? Also as an update to my draft problem I haven't noticed them sleeping in a pile since we closed some vents so I think they are happier. They are sleeping up on roosts now and not even all that close to each other.
If they are comfortably spaced, fluffed out but not bunched, they are fine.I know chickens are fine in the cold as long as they have a dry draft free coop, but in theory would i be able to tell if them were cold?
